What happens when you’re caught between putting food on the table and chasing what God put in your heart? In this episode, we break down the mindset of faith, perseverance, and purpose when you’re stuck working a 9–5 but your spirit is screaming for more. Jerry opens up about his personal journey from struggle to trust, from street hustle to spiritual hustle, and what it really means to keep believing even when the bills say otherwise.

Main Themes

•Balancing responsibility with purpose choosing groceries and the dream.

•Building faith when life feels like survival mode.

•The power of outlasting your struggle through Christ.

•Turning street smarts into kingdom wisdom.

•Practicing your craft while working your 9–5 how to grow where you’re planted.
